2014-09-04 - Identified through information in Casavant documents, courtesy of Simon Couture and Denis Blaine. The cost was $3,855.00. -Database Manager
2017-01-24 - Originally installed in First Lutheran Church, Winnipeg, in 1906; relocated to St. Boniface R. C. Cathedral in 1921; rebuilt and enlarged to 4-manual 40-stops in 1955 as Casavant Op. 2282; destroyed by fire July 22, 1968. -Database Manager
